Overview
IEC 60364-5-53:2019/AMD1:2020 is an important amendment to the international standard governing low-voltage electrical installations. Specifically, it addresses the selection and erection of electrical equipment focused on devices for protection including safety, isolation, switching, control, and monitoring. This amendment supplements Part 5-53 of IEC 60364-5-53, providing updated guidelines and clarifications on protective devices critical to preventing electric shock and ensuring safe electrical system operation.
The standard was developed by the IEC Technical Committee 64, specializing in electrical installations and protection against electric shock. It forms part of the widely recognized IEC 60364 series that defines global best practices and regulatory requirements for electrical installations in residential, commercial, and industrial environments.
Key Topics
-
Automatic Disconnection of Supply: The amendment outlines requirements for devices used to automatically disconnect supply in fault conditions, including overcurrent protective devices and residual current devices (RCDs). It emphasizes correct device placement upstream of protected circuits and suitability for isolation.
-
Protection Mechanisms Covered:
- Automatic disconnection of supply
- Double or reinforced insulation
- Electrical separation
- Extra-low voltage via SELV and PELV systems
- Additional protection devices for enhanced safety
-
Device Selection by Earthing Systems:
- TN, TT, IT system considerations for device selection and operating characteristics
- Coordination between protective devices to reduce unwanted tripping
- Special conditions for RCDs usage according to earthing arrangement, ensuring proper fault current interruption
-
RCD Types and Application:
- Selection based on the waveform of residual currents (AC and DC components)
- Detailed criteria on the coordination of RCDs connected in series
- Differentiation of device requirements depending on accessibility (e.g., ordinary persons, trained personnel)
- Compliance with IEC 61008, IEC 61009, IEC 62423, and IEC 60947-2 standards for the various kinds of RCDs and circuit breakers incorporating residual current protection
-
Fault Loop Impedance and Disconnection Times:
- Strict formulas ensuring that protective devices operate within required times to limit electric shock risks
- Fault loop considerations involving source, line conductor, protective conductor, and earth electrodes

Related Standards
IEC 60364-5-53:2019/AMD1:2020 references and harmonizes with several key IEC standards that are integral to electrical protection devices:
- IEC 60364-4-41: Protection against electric shock; foundational requirements for disconnection times and fault protection.
- IEC 60947-2: Circuit breakers including types with residual current protection (CBRs, MRCDs).
- IEC 61008 series: Residual current operated circuit breakers without integral overcurrent protection (RCCBs).
- IEC 61009 series: Residual current operated circuit breakers with integral overcurrent protection (RCBOs).
- IEC 62423: Requirements for combined residual current devices.
- IEC TS 63053: Guidelines on DC residual current devices.
